Understanding the Importance of Real-Time Measurement
Accurate measurements are critical in industries such as manufacturing, construction, and quality control. A cross sectional shape and size measuring device with real-time data offers a multitude of benefits that can enhance precision and efficiency. Traditional measurement methods often rely on manual readings and can be time-consuming, leading to potential errors. However, real-time technologies streamline the process, allowing for instant feedback and faster decision-making.
Advantages of Real-Time Measuring Devices
Among the primary advantages of utilizing a cross sectional shape and size measuring device with real-time data is the ability to monitor changes as they occur. This capability is particularly useful in industries where small deviations can lead to significant downstream effects. For instance, in the manufacturing sector, real-time measurements can help detect defects early in the production process, reducing waste and improving product quality.
Moreover, real-time measuring devices are increasingly compatible with other technologies, such as Internet of Things (IoT) systems. This integration allows for data collection and analysis, enabling users to identify trends and make informed predictions about future performance. The synergy between real-time measurements and IoT technology is fostering a new era of data-driven decision-making.

The versatility of a cross sectional shape and size measuring device with real-time data makes it applicable in various industries. In aerospace engineering, for instance, precise measurements are essential for ensuring safety and efficiency. Engineers can utilize these devices to examine the contours and dimensions of components, confirming they meet stringent industry standards.
In the automotive sector, manufacturers are increasingly adopting real-time measurement technologies to enhance production efficiency. By integrating these devices into their assembly lines, they can monitor the dimensions of parts throughout the manufacturing process, ensuring that every component fits perfectly within the larger assembly.
Furthermore, the medical field has room for the application of real-time measuring devices. Ensuring precise measurements in the production of medical devices is crucial, as even minor variances could lead to significant complications. This technology ensures that all dimensions are within expected tolerances, thereby improving patient safety.
